When you look at their results, 2v1 derby, 1v2 QPR, 1v0 Cardiff,  2v1 Newcastle and 0v2 Rotherham.

What strikes me about that list is that Wednesday grind out wins and that they rely on teams not scoring to win. That list is also much easier on paper than our last 4 wins and look at our scores. 3v1 x3 and 4v1.

Nobody in this division can stop us scoring, something has really clicked. It's the pace, up until recently our build up play was much slower and patient. Now it's fluid and direct. It's unstoppable imo.

So Wednesday would have to do something they don't do often and clearly aren't comfortable doing. Scoring more than 2 goals and outscoring us. I just don't see anyone being capable of doing that now.

We could lose both our remaining games and still be in the playoffs as long as Leeds only get a maximum 3 points.

That said, if we think our form is good - Sheffield Wednesday's is the best in the league... and as someone mentioned earlier they grind out performances... which doesn't sound too dissimilar to when they played us - they really harried and played a dirty game against us, but it worked and we drew courtesy of an injury time equaliser from Scott Malone.

Our line up has changed a bit since then though.

We started with Button, Sigurdsson, Piazon, Martin and brought on Odoi, Parker and Ayite as subs...

Now Ayite and Neeskens are more of a threat, so is Sessegnon... Sigurdsson and Button aren't in the team at the moment.. Piazon is currently coming on as a sub and Martin - I don't know - will he be available for the Wednesday game?
